The quality of industrial, municipal or hospital waters varies greatly throughout the days and seasons. Because usually one of the first steps of water treatment plants (WWTPs) is biological treatment (after mechanical cleaning) it is vital that this step operates at full capacity. However, toxic compounds such as antibiotics, which are in use for human consumption or animal agriculture can greatly disrupt this stage of cleaning due to their antibiological nature of operation. Technion has developed a system in which toxicity to bacteria is measured on-line. It is based on following spectral changes in a dye, which is reduced as part of bacterial metabolism, which depends on the level of toxicity. The measured toxicity values are fed to a PID controller, which controls the operation of an AOP reactor. This system was developed as part of "Project O", a H2020 program of the European Commission.
